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5376388 6862617382 52492916565
25667574 09015559
25667574 09015559
3732 4885563 0260356 3382
All about undefined
Interested in learning more?
25667574 09015559
3732 4885563 0260356 3382
See more
23258827151 5818024
942 255964 17131588761 006652 51360045
See more
1230140 94599215970 898
437555 74 134559
See more